GeoHECRAS is the BEST
I do quick studies, where FEMA mapping does not exist, to determine how much of a property is developable for potential developers. I size stream crossings for FEMA “No-Rise” situations. I analyze FEMA floodways where they would be impacted by crossings I size using the software. Mapping is updated by the click of a button for any changes.
PROSI like the ease of use and fast productivity. I can set up a model from scratch and determine flood elevations in 4 hours. That requires selecting the orthophoto and importing a CAD file to use as a background, importing contours (or LIDAR), turning them into a DTM (which it does very fast), drawing the reach centerline, cutting cross sections, inserting a crossing (if needed), turning on FEMA flood data (FIRM info), determine base flows using USGS Stream Stats inside the software (faster than using a web browser), and I have base flood elevations and floodplain mapping in 4 hours! Excellent HEC-RAS interface, with LIDAR processing ability and great tech service.
GeoHEC-RAS has all the reliability and advantages of the HEC-RAS program, with several crucial extra features. These extras features have saved time and money for our company and clients on countless projects. The savings and convenience caused us to switch and the friendly, responsive tech service has kept us as loyal GeoHECRAS customers.
PROSGeoHECRAS combines an easy-to-use HEC-RAS interface with the ability to use field survey data and use and process LIDAR. I have found the tech service to be fast, friendly, and responsive. If you have any issues or want to see a new feature, just let them know. I have been using GeoHECRAS regularly for over seven years. I have seen several of my requested features and fixes incorporated into the program. Switching from HEC-RAS to GeoHECRAS is easy and intuitive, since it the workflows are similar and the hydraulic engine is the same. GeoHECRAS models can be easily exported to HEC-RAS format when necessary (or when the client requires it).

Reasons for switching to GeoHECRAS
GeoHEC-RAS has the reliability of the HEC-RAS hydraulic engine and report maker, with several crucial extra features. GeoHECRAS can use and process LIDAR data (without a separate GIS program), as well as conflate field survey data directly onto cross-sections. It turns CAD entities into terrains, centerlines, and cross sections with just a few clicks. These extras features have saved much time and money for our company and clients.
